Meaning:
Necrotizing skin infections refer to a group of severe bacterial infections that affect the skin, subcutaneous tissues, and, in some cases, underlying fascial layers. These infections are characterized by the rapid progression of tissue necrosis, requiring prompt and aggressive medical intervention. Necrotizing skin infections can result from various bacterial pathogens, including Group A Streptococcus, Staphylococcus aureus, and other mixed bacterial flora.

Key Market Insights:
- Multimodal Treatment Approaches: Effective treatment of necrotizing skin infections often involves a multimodal approach, including surgical debridement, broad-spectrum antibiotics, supportive care, and, in some cases, hyperbaric oxygen therapy.
- Antimicrobial Resistance Concerns: The rise of antimicrobial resistance poses challenges in the selection of appropriate antibiotics for necrotizing skin infections. Ongoing surveillance and research aim to address resistance patterns and optimize treatment strategies.
- Wound Care Innovations: Advances in wound care technologies play a crucial role in the management of necrotizing skin infections. Innovative wound dressings, tissue engineering approaches, and regenerative therapies contribute to improved wound healing.
- Clinical Guidelines and Protocols: The development and dissemination of clinical guidelines and protocols for the management of necrotizing skin infections help standardize treatment approaches and enhance healthcare practitioners’ decision-making.

Market Restraints:
- Challenges in Early Diagnosis: The difficulty in early diagnosis of necrotizing skin infections, often due to the rapid progression of symptoms and the variability in clinical presentations, poses a challenge in initiating timely and targeted treatment.
- Limited Treatment Options: The limited availability of specific antimicrobial agents effective against all potential causative pathogens, coupled with the complexity of necrotizing skin infections, limits the treatment options available to healthcare practitioners.
- Risk of Surgical Complications: Surgical debridement, a key component of treatment, carries inherent risks, including the potential for extensive tissue loss, complications, and the need for reconstructive procedures.
- Resource Intensiveness: The management of necrotizing skin infections can be resource-intensive, requiring specialized healthcare facilities, skilled surgical teams, and comprehensive support services.
